Scey-sur-Saône-et- Saint-Albin is a commune with 1,545 inhabitants (at January 1, 2017) in the department of Haute-Saône in the region Bourgogne Franche-Comté ; it belongs to the arrondissement of Vesoul and is the capital of the canton of the same name Scey-sur-Saône-et-Saint-Albin and the community association Communauté de communes des Combes .

geography

The municipality is located around 40 kilometers northeast of Gray and 15 kilometers northwest of Vesoul on the right bank of the Upper Saône . Are neighboring communities

The municipality's capital is located in a bend in the river Saône, which in this area can be navigated by inland waterway vessels . However, the driveway shortens the river bend with a shortcut canal that runs just south of the municipality. Nevertheless, a port for sport boats and houseboats is operated here in its own area . The municipality also includes the town of Saint-Albin , namesake for the Saint-Albin tunnel, which has its upstream tunnel portal in the extreme southwest of the municipality and enables shipping to shorten another loop of the Saône.

traffic

The municipality is crossed in the north by the national road N19 , which leads from Langres to Vesoul . The actual traffic-related supply of the area takes place via the departmental roads D3 (from Combeaufontaine towards Besançon ) and D23 (connection to the national road N19).

Attractions

  • Château de Scey-sur-Saône , 19th century castle, monument historique
  • Église Saint-Martin , 18th century church, monument historique
  • Calvaire Sainte-Anne , cross sculpture from the 17th century, Monument historique
  • Souterrain de Saint-Albin , canal tunnel from the 19th century, Monument historique
